About the Role
Bloomsbury Publishing is seeking a Fall Marketing and Publicity Intern for its Special Interest team to assist in the publication and promotion of specialty nonfiction books. Interns will not be working with Sarah J. Maas titles nor YA/Children’s books.
Responsibilities
- Attending editorial meetings
- Completing publicity, influencer, and institutional research
- Drafting galley letters, press releases, and marketing materials
- Assisting the publicity department in media tracking and pitching
- Contributing content to our social media accounts
- Managing departmental shipping
- Providing administrative support to the marketing and publicity team
- Updating data systems as-needed

About the Company
- Bloomsbury USA is an independent, author-focused publishing house that is committed to bringing groundbreaking fiction and expertise-driven nonfiction to a global audience.
- Bloomsbury’s team of editors, publicists, marketers, and production staff bring their depth of experience and enthusiasm to their books every day.
- Recently, Bloomsbury USA has published the New York Times bestselling Among the Burning Flowers by Samantha Shannon, the New York Times bestselling The Golden Road by William Dalryple, the New York Times bestselling Money, Lies, and God by Katherine Stewart, the USA Today bestselling Bog Queen by Anna North, and the critically acclaimed The Anthropologists and Long Distance by Aysegül Savas.
